crypto: polyval - Rename conflicting functions

Rename polyval_init() and polyval_update(), in preparation for adding
library functions with the same name to <crypto/polyval.h>.

Note that polyval-generic.c will be removed later, as it will be
superseded by the library.  This commit just keeps the kernel building
for the initial introduction of the library.
